Post War Situation in Kosovo

The present situation for Croats in Kosovo is as described: 'With the downfall of Milošević's policy in Kosovo and with the exodus of most of the Serb population, the survival of the remaining Croat population also became uncertain. Albanian plunderers from neighbouring villages terrorised them and as a result they asked Croatia to help them leave Letnica collectively.

There is an attempt in progress to find a proper place for them in Croatia, and to enable it to take them all together on secure ground.
